All of the surround mode functions in our devices work in different ways, and some might be useful in certain situations. Here is a list of each mode, explained with more details. HVS surround mode: Is the abbreviation for HARMAN Virtual Surround. It will process the signal to simulate a surround effect from a stereo source. DSP Bypass: Surround Off (DSP or Analog Bypass) = 2 CH STEREO. When this mode is selected, the BDS will pass the analog source material directly through to the front left and right speakers, bypassing the digital processing circuitry. Stereo mode: Turns off all surround processing and plays a pure two-channel signal or a downmix of a multichannel signal. The signal is digitized and bass management settings are applied, making it appropriate when a subwoofer is used. Pulse-code modulation (PCM): This method is used to digitally represent sampled analog signals, and two channels (stereo) is the most common format. PCM Stereo is what standard Audio CDs always use. Dynamic Range Control: This setting makes the loud and quiet parts of a movie or music sound closer to the same volume (a process known as compression). Compression lets you turn up the volume so you can hear the quiet parts without the loud parts disturbing other people. NOTE: This feature works only with Dolby Digital programs that have been specially encoded. Three settings are available: •• Off: Never applies compression. Use this setting when the volume may be as loud as you desire. •• On: Always applies compression. Use this setting when you want the volume to be as quiet as possible without making it difficult to hear spoken dialogue. •• Auto: Applies compression based on information encoded within the Dolby Digital bit-stream. The receiver will selectively apply compression only during the most dynamic parts of the soundtrack.Was this helpful? Thank you for your feedback!

FOD (foreign object detection) is a security guarantee that must be included in Qi certification.
This means our Infinity Lab Qi-certified power bank can detect if a foreign object, such as metal, is on its surface.
If that happens, the wireless charger either stops charging or does not start charging at all.Was this helpful? Thank you for your feedback! -

All AVR models up to and including 151S, 161S and 171S feature HDCP version 1.4. (High-bandwidth Digital Content Protection). This is also true for BDS 280, 580, 280S and 580S. It is not possible to update to version 2.2 with any software/firmware update, as this requires a hardware change. Future models may feature version 2.2, made for UHD/4k content.Was this helpful? "Sports Mode" enhances your work-out experience by adapting the ambient sound level and the EQ settings. This feature can be turned on in the JBL Headphones app. "Sports Mode" include outdoor walking, hiking, outdoor running, elliptical, indoor running and functional training.
When "Sports Mode" is turned on, the Ambient Sound Control and the assigned gestures will be temporarily disabled. Both Ambient Sound Control and the assigned gestures will be turned on again once "Sports Mode" is turned off.

We use the microphones on the outside of the earcup to pick up the outside ambient noise and play through the headphone. With the unique JBL solution, the user can adjust the level of the ambient noise up or down, and the balance from left to right, so that they are in full control of how loud the ambient sound is in each earcup.Was this helpful? HDCP stands for High-bandwidth Digital Content Protection. In short term, this is used to protect 4K material from illegal pirating. Every device in your chain system, must support HDCP 2.2, meaning if your 4K Blue-Ray player has HDCP 2.2, then your Soundbar must support it (SB450 does) and TV as well, or else you won't see any 4K material. In case your TV do not support HDCP 2.2, then it will downscale to 1080P content, this is done by the Blue-Ray player.Was this helpful? Thank you for your feedback!

JBL Pro Sound is achieved through robust 40mm Mica Dome drivers, which are precisely tuned to deliver deep bass, balanced mids and crystal-clear highs. Each Mica Dome deliver refined high frequencies above 40kHz for the best on-the-go listening experience. Mica is a renewable mineral that can be split into extremely thin elastic plates, making it flexible enough to respond fast and precisely to the electrical signals in headphone drivers.

JBL Safe Sound is an added parental control toy can use in the JBL Headphones app. You can set the max volume and for how long kids can listen for. With "time-up" reminders, parents can even record their own voice prompt notifications.
It's also possible to receive daily and weekly activity reports on volume and time exposure to help maintain safe listening habits.
A PIN Code protects the max volume limit and daily time limit from being modified.

The Low Volume Dynamic EQ feature can optimize EQ, boosts low and high frequencies to maintain the same high-fidelity performance at low volume. When you listen to music in low volume, the whole music dynamic will be decreased due to low and high frequency volume reduction. Some music is best to enjoy at a higher volume, but this approach can hurt your ears. With Low Volume Dynamic EQ, you can still receive an enjoyable music experience even in low or high volume, and still protect your ears without compromising on the listening experience.
